Pubs, Restaurants & Bars

Pubs

We’re lucky to have two great pubs just a short walk away. If you’re heading out on foot, don’t forget to borrow one of our torches and stay on the footpath!

First up is the Brown Cow in Chatburn. Simply step out of the front door and follow the footpath down to Chatburn. The Brown Cow offers hearty, no-nonsense food, and they’ve got a great selection of local real ales, fine wines, and over 40 gins at their gin bar. Whether you’re soaking up the sun in their beer garden or cosying up by the fire, the warm welcome is always guaranteed.

Turning left towards the picturesque village of Downham, you can follow the same footpath in the opposite direction to reach the Assheton Arms. This quaint pub with a snazzy restaurant offers a delightful bistro-style menu. Managed by James’ Places, it naturally boasts the full range of Bowland Brewery beers. Whether you’re after a pint of local ale or a well-crafted dish, the Assheton Arms serves up a perfect blend of charm and quality.

A little further afield by car (but well worth the scenic drive), you’ll find the historic Inn at Whitewell. This 16th-century former coaching inn sits majestically above the River Hodder, offering breathtaking views of the surrounding countryside and distant fells. Their fish pie is a must-try, and for wine lovers, there’s a delightful little wine shop next to the reception area—perfect for picking up a bottle or two to take home.

If it’s home-cooked fare you’re after, we highly recommend The Swan With Two Necks in Pendleton, just a 10-minute drive from Greendale. As a CAMRA award-winning pub, you’ll be spoiled for choice with their excellent range of real ales. The food is simple but delicious, often complemented by a specials board. In winter, you can cosy up by the roaring fire, while in summer, the front of the pub is perfect for soaking up the sunshine with a pint in hand.

Restaurants

If fine dining is your passion, then Northcote is an absolute must. With a Michelin star proudly held for over 25 years, every meal here is a true celebration of flavour and craftsmanship. Executive Chef Lisa Goodwin-Allen and her talented brigade are dedicated to showcasing the finest produce, honouring each ingredient with precision. Complementing the outstanding dishes is an award-winning wine list, all delivered with real Northern hospitality.

The White Swan in Fence is a vibrant pub that excels in serving fantastic food, a superb selection of wines, and award-winning Timothy Taylor’s real ales—the only pub in Lancashire to have earned a Michelin Star. Their small, seasonal set menu showcases fresh, carefully sourced ingredients.

Michael’s former boss, Nigel Haworth, has long been a passionate advocate for Lancashire produce and now showcases his commitment at The Three Fishes in Mitton, where he cultivates his own vegetable garden. The à la carte menu features unpretentious delights like tempura scallops and flavourful corn-fed chicken. For those seeking a more immersive experience, there’s a seasonal set menu available in either 5 or 8 courses, beautifully bookended by cheese rolls and mini Eccles cakes—beloved staples that have rightfully earned their place on the menu.

Fairly new on the scene, The Rum Fox in Grindleton is a beautifully renovated former pub that’s quickly gaining a reputation for its exceptional food and warm hospitality. Just a short drive from Greendale Teahouse, it’s well worth a visit for those looking to explore the local dining scene.

Yu - Copster Green is the destination for exquisite and authentic Chinese fine dining. Chef Victor Yu’s career started as a KP for his father Charlie Yu in 1989, before moving to front of house then starting in the kitchen as a chef at the age of 22. Combined with the skills learnt from his father, collaborations with other well- known chefs, and travels across Asia, Victor honed and refined his style, becoming head chef at 28. You simply must try the Honey Roast Char Sui Pork or Charlie Yu’s Chicken Curry.

La Locanda is a charming Italian restaurant located in Gisburn, just a short drive from Greendale Teahouse. Known for its incredible homemade bread and pasta hand-crafted by Agri-Chef Maurizio, La Locanda offers a delightful menu that showcases authentic Italian cuisine made with the finest local ingredients (no pizza or lasagna here!). Maurizio’s wife, Cinzia, who looks after the dining room, is incredibly knowledgeable about Italian wines and extra virgin olive oil, ensuring you have the perfect pairing with your meal. The warm, inviting atmosphere makes it a fantastic spot for a relaxed dining experience, whether you’re stopping by for lunch or enjoying a special dinner.

In Clitheroe, we wholeheartedly recommend Brizola, a fantastic Greek-inspired restaurant run by Racheal, a proud Lancashire lass. Her culinary skills shine as she crafts Greek dishes that are truly exceptional—many say she cooks Greek food better than the Greeks themselves! Another delightful option is Tom’s Table, a charming bistro situated in the heart of Clitheroe, offering a variety of delicious meals in a warm and inviting setting. Both spots are perfect for a lovely meal after exploring the local area.

Bars

The Whalley Wine Bar is a rare gem in the UK, offering an authentic wine bar experience. Operated by the same team behind ‘The Whalley Wine Shop’ next door, it boasts an impressive and extensive wine list that is sure to delight. In addition to their superb selection of wines, they serve a range of small plates perfect for sharing. To ensure a spot—whether for a leisurely drink or a meal—it’s advisable to book a table in advance.

More wine enthusiasts will find their haven at Will’s in Clitheroe, which offers a larger dining experience alongside a good wine selection. Following its success in Barrowford, Will’s opened a second branch in the former NatWest bank in summer 2024, bringing its celebrated offerings closer to us. They offer a large range of wines, beers, spirits, an ever changing tapas style menu & stone baked pizzas.

For a vibrant atmosphere, Keystreet Bar in Clitheroe is the place to be. While drinks may be a touch pricier, the lively ambiance is well worth it, featuring an eclectic mix of music, often accompanied by live performances. It’s a perfect spot to unwind with a drink and enjoy the tunes late into the night.

The Beer Shack in Clitheroe is a must-visit for beer enthusiasts. They offer an impressive selection of exciting and innovative beer styles, from refreshing IPAs to rich stouts and tangy sours. With a rotating variety of guest beers from craft breweries across the UK and beyond, there’s always something new to try. Whether you’re a seasoned beer connoisseur or just looking to explore, The Beer Shack is the perfect spot to enjoy some of the finest local brews.

The Parlour Cocktail Bar, nestled in Wellgate, Clitheroe, is the perfect spot for cocktail aficionados and casual drinkers alike. Renowned for its vibrant atmosphere and expertly crafted cocktails, this stylish bar offers a diverse menu featuring both classic and innovative concoctions. With good reviews from patrons, it’s a great place to unwind and enjoy a night out with friends.
